To get started with this particular recipe, we have to first prepare a few ingredients. You can have watermelon wedges with feta and mint using 4 ingredients and 4 steps. Here is how you can achieve it.

The ingredients needed to make Watermelon Wedges With Feta And Mint:
  1. Prepare 1 seedless watermelon
  2. Take Crumbled feta cheese
  3. Prepare Fresh mint leaves (use the smallest ones)
  4. Take Fresh ground black pepper

Steps to make Watermelon Wedges With Feta And Mint:
  1. Depending on the size of the watermelon, cut lengthwise into 4 or 6 pieces. Then cut each piece into wedges.
  2. Place wedges on individual appetizer plates or a large platter and sprinkle with crumbled feta cheese.
  3. Decorate with small mint leaves.
  4. Add a few grinds of black pepper before serving.
